Output 581b702256996cde5b1feaa1d78966af71108b8e1bb459e0cbbb00d121b57584:45

value
30180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 839852eb213f69b99e58733138718ee64e2566ce OP_EQUAL
address
3DgpvKj6b5ngjA2uLSUgkRUv9hS93deHRL
transaction
581b702256996cde5b1feaa1d78966af71108b8e1bb459e0cbbb00d121b57584
spent
true